Orange Township voters approve levy renewal

By Paula Pyzik Scott

The Hancock County Board of Elections has released unofficial results for Orange Township elections. Voters approved a tax levy renewal and elected Thomas D. Wagner and Jeff Scoles as trustees.

Orange Township Tax Levy (1 of 1 precincts reported)

For The Tax Levy 131 67.88%

Against The Tax Levy 62 32.12%

TOTAL 193

Voters approved "A renewal of a tax for the benefit of Orange Township, Hancock County, Ohio, for the purpose of current expenses, that the county auditor estimates will collect $59,035 annually, at a rate not exceeding 1 mill for each $1 of taxable value, which amounts to $30 for each $100,000 of the county auditor’s appraised value, for five years, commencing in 2026, first due in calendar year 2027."

Three candidates vied for two trustee positions. Thomas D. Wagner was reelected. Candidate Jeff Scoles unseated incumbent David Warren.

Orange Township Trustee Vote For 2 (1 of 1 precincts reported)

Thomas D. Wagner 139 41.87%

Jeff Scoles 113 34.04%

David Warren 80 24.10%

TOTAL 332
